Biography
Bo Holten (born 22 October 1948) is a Danish composer and conductor.
He has been the principal conductor for the vocal ensembles Ars Nova (Copenhagen) and Musica Ficta (Denmark), as well as guest-conductor for the BBC Singers. He was the principal conductor for the Flemish Radio Choir (Vlaams Radio Koor) in Brussels until 2012.
As a composer he has written more than 100 works, including 6 operas, 2 musicals, 2 symphonies, and 5 solo concertos. He has also composed several film scores, amongst them the music for Lars Von Trier's The Element of Crime. Biography at Edition Wilhelm Hansen (publisher)
